BACKGROUND
A significant portion of Canadian households lack first aid training. ER shortages and ambulance delays mean professional help may not arrive in time. First aid training empowers bystanders to act immediately, closing the gap between a moment of crisis and the care that follows.

98% of all Canadians believe first aid is important but only 18% are currently certified. Nearly 40% of Canadians have already faced an emergency requiring first aid and 60% of the time, it involved a family member. Canadians recognize the signs of an emergency but either aren’t confident enough to act in the emergency or lack the skills to respond.
